Official DSMZ medium: This medium was manually curated by experts from the DSMZ.
| Compound | Amount | Unit | Conc. [g/L] | Conc. [mM] | |
|---|---|---|---|---|---|
| KCl | 0.34 | g | 0.336 | 4.502 | |
| MgCl2 x 6 H2O | 4.00 | g | 3.949 | 19.423 | |
| MgSO4 x 7 H2O | 3.45 | g | 3.406 | 13.818 | |
| NH4Cl | 0.25 | g | 0.247 | 4.614 | |
| CaCl2 x 2 H2O | 0.14 | g | 0.138 | 0.94 | |
| K2HPO4 | 0.14 | g | 0.138 | 0.793 | |
| NaCl | 18.00 | g | 17.769 | 304.055 | |
| Modified Wolin's mineral solution | 10.00 | ml | - | - | |
|
Fe(NH4)2(SO4)2 x 6 H2O
(0.1% w/v) |
2.00 | ml | 0.002 | - | |
| Na-acetate | 1.00 | g | 0.987 | 12.034 | |
|
Yeast extract
(OXOID) |
2.00 | g | 1.974 | - | |
|
Trypticase peptone
(BD BBL) |
2.00 | g | 1.974 | - | |
|
Sodium resazurin
(0.1% w/v) |
0.50 | ml | 4.9e-4 | 0.002 | |
| NaHCO3 | 5.00 | g | 4.936 | 58.755 | |
| Trimethylammonium chloride | 5.00 | g | 4.936 | 51.646 | |
| Wolin's vitamin solution (10x) | 1.00 | ml | - | - | |
| L-Cysteine HCl x H2O | 0.50 | g | 0.494 | 2.81 | |
| Na2S x 9 H2O | 0.50 | g | 0.494 | 2.055 | |
| Distilled water | 1000.00 | ml | - | - | |
| 1 Dissolve ingredients (except bicarbonate, trimethylammonium chloride, vitamins, cysteine and sulfide), sparge medium with 80% N2 and 20% CO2 gas mixture for 30 - 45 min to make it anoxic. Add and dissolve bicarbonate and adjust pH to 6.8, then dispense medium under 80% N2 and 20% CO2 gas atmosphere into anoxic Hungate-type tubes or serum vials to 30% of their volume and autoclave. After sterilization add trimethylammonium chloride, cysteine and sulfide from sterile anoxic stock solutions autoclaved under 100% N2 gas atmosphere. Vitamins are prepared under 100% N2 gas atmosphere and sterilized by filtration. Adjust pH of complete medium to 7.0 - 7.4, if necessary. | |||||
| Compound | Amount | Unit | Conc. [g/L] | Conc. [mM] | |
|---|---|---|---|---|---|
| Nitrilotriacetic acid | 1.50 | g | 1.5 | 7.848 | |
| MgSO4 x 7 H2O | 3.00 | g | 3 | 12.172 | |
| MnSO4 x H2O | 0.50 | g | 0.5 | 2.958 | |
| NaCl | 1.00 | g | 1 | 17.112 | |
| FeSO4 x 7 H2O | 0.10 | g | 0.1 | 0.36 | |
| CoSO4 x 7 H2O | 0.18 | g | 0.18 | 1.161 | |
| CaCl2 x 2 H2O | 0.10 | g | 0.1 | 0.68 | |
| ZnSO4 x 7 H2O | 0.18 | g | 0.18 | 0.626 | |
| CuSO4 x 5 H2O | 0.01 | g | 0.01 | 0.04 | |
| AlK(SO4)2 x 12 H2O | 0.02 | g | 0.02 | 0.042 | |
| H3BO3 | 0.01 | g | 0.01 | 0.162 | |
| Na2MoO4 x 2 H2O | 0.01 | g | 0.01 | 0.041 | |
| NiCl2 x 6 H2O | 0.03 | g | 0.03 | 0.231 | |
| Na2SeO3 x 5 H2O | 0.30 | mg | 3.0e-4 | 0.001 | |
| Na2WO4 x 2 H2O | 0.40 | mg | 4.0e-4 | 0.001 | |
| Distilled water | 1000.00 | ml | - | - | |
| 1 First dissolve nitrilotriacetic acid and adjust pH to 6.5 with KOH, then add minerals. Adjust final to pH 7.0 with KOH. | |||||
